08.11.2017 Views

arduino_básico_Michael_McRoberts

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

Capítulo 7 ■ Displays de LED<br />

185<br />

Assim, a letra A, código ASCII 65, é armazenada no elemento 33 do array (65 - 32), e<br />

a segunda dimensão do array naquele índice armazena os oito padrões de bits que<br />

formam essa letra. A letra Z, código ASCII 90, é o número de índice 58 no array. Os<br />

dados em font[33][0...8], para a letra A, correspondem a:<br />

{B00001110, B00010001, B00010001, B00010001, B00011111, B00010001, B00010001, B00010001},<br />

Se você posicionar esses dados individualmente, para analisá-los mais claramente,<br />

terá como resultado:<br />

B00001110<br />

B00010001<br />

B00010001<br />

B00010001<br />

B00011111<br />

B00010001<br />

B00010001<br />

B00010001<br />

Se analisar mais de perto, você verá o padrão seguinte, que forma a letra A:<br />

Para a letra Z, os dados no array são:<br />

B00011111<br />

B00000001<br />

B00000010<br />

B00000100<br />

B00001000<br />

B00010000<br />

B00010000<br />

B00011111<br />

O que corresponde ao seguinte padrão de bits no LED:

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!